Output 778d867eb61e25cfcd95112cb2cc429b786b0a3768a51c5c9f86faeeb8a57187:1

value
2287509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623014859e53e7a03a996f17277b3f90023ee5da OP_EQUAL
address
3AeBk1ctchydBVbb14a2aXN9JWvtEZzq9c
transaction
778d867eb61e25cfcd95112cb2cc429b786b0a3768a51c5c9f86faeeb8a57187
spent
true